Starship Test: Partial Explosion, Yet a Partial Success

SpaceX's ambitious Starship test flight ended in a spectacular, albeit partially successful, explosion. The highly anticipated launch, viewed by millions worldwide, marked a significant milestone in the development of SpaceX's next-generation reusable launch system, despite the fiery conclusion. While the complete integration of Starship and Super Heavy booster remains a work in progress, data gathered during the flight offers valuable insights for future iterations. This article delves into the key takeaways from the test, examining both the successes and the areas needing improvement.

A Giant Leap, Followed by a Fiery Descent

The launch itself was breathtaking. The Super Heavy booster, a colossal rocket boasting 33 Raptor 2 engines, ignited with tremendous power, lifting the Starship spacecraft towards the heavens. Initial reports indicated that all engines functioned nominally during the ascent phase, a crucial success for a system of this complexity. However, the planned orbital insertion and subsequent controlled descent did not proceed as envisioned. The upper stage, Starship, experienced some anomalies during its flight, leading to a planned controlled self-destruct sequence upon re-entry. The subsequent explosion over the Gulf of Mexico confirmed the termination of the flight.

What Went Right During the Starship Test Flight?

Despite the explosive finale, several aspects of the Starship test flight can be considered successes:

  • Successful Super Heavy Booster Ignition and Ascent: The sheer power and successful lift-off of the Super Heavy booster, a feat in itself, represent a major accomplishment. This demonstrated the capability of the 33 Raptor 2 engines to work in unison.
  • Data Acquisition: SpaceX emphasized the importance of data collection throughout the mission. The wealth of information gathered during the flight, encompassing telemetry from various sensors and systems, will prove invaluable for future design improvements and software updates.
  • Ground System Performance: The ground systems at Starbase, Boca Chica, performed remarkably well, a testament to the extensive infrastructure built to support Starship launches.

Areas Requiring Further Development

While the successes are noteworthy, the test also highlighted areas needing further development:

  • Starship Separation and Control: The separation of Starship from the Super Heavy booster seemed to have occurred, but the subsequent control and trajectory adjustments faced challenges, leading to the unscheduled explosive termination. Further analysis is required to identify the root causes.
  • Heat Shield Performance: Analysis of the heat shield's performance during re-entry is critical. The intense heat generated during atmospheric re-entry is a considerable engineering challenge, and data from this flight will inform future heat shield designs.
  • Engine Performance During Flight: While the initial ignition was successful, assessing the performance of the Raptor 2 engines throughout the entire flight is crucial. Any anomalies or inconsistencies must be thoroughly investigated.

The Future of Starship

The partial explosion of the Starship prototype doesn't diminish the significance of the test flight. SpaceX CEO Elon Musk himself described the test as a "rapid unscheduled disassembly," highlighting the iterative nature of rocket development. The data gathered is now being thoroughly analyzed to inform the design and testing of future Starship iterations. SpaceX plans to conduct further tests, progressively addressing the issues identified in this initial launch.

The long-term goal remains to create a fully reusable and supremely efficient launch system capable of transporting large payloads to orbit, and potentially beyond.
